Commentaries:
Adam Clarke
Into the draught - See on Matthew 15:17 (note).
Purging all meats? - For what is separated from the different aliments taken into the stomach, and thrown out of the body, is the innutritious parts of all the meats that are eaten; and thus they are purged, nothing being left behind but what is proper for the support of the body.
